Research
My research lies in applied probability, with a focus on reinforcement learning (RL) algorithms in hard-exploration environments — settings where reward signals are sparse or highly stochastic. I study these problems through the framework of rare event estimation and simulation, using tools from stochastic processes, measure changes via exponential martingales, large deviation principles, and Feynman–Kac semigroups.
